Influence of magnetic ordering on the phonon Raman spectra in YCrO3 and GdCrO3
Authors:M Udagawa  K Kohn  N Koshizuka  T Tsushima  K Tsushima
Institution:School of Science and Engineering, Waseda University, Shinjuku-ku, Tokyo 160, Japan;Electrotechnical Laboratory, Tanashi, Tokyo 188, Japan;Broadcasting Science Research Laboratories of Nippon Hôsô Kyokai, Kinuta, Setagaya-ku, Tokyo 157, Japan
Abstract:A1g and B2g phonon Raman lines with frequencies of ≈ 560 cm-1 in YCrO3 and GdCrO3 show large blue shift from a little above the Néel temperature to lower temperatures. The contribution of the volume exchange striction to the frequency shift is estimated to be about 30 to 40 per cent for the A1g and B2g lines, respectively.
